味同嚼蠟味如嚼蠟wèi tóng jué làit is like chewing wax—insipid; tasteless ? 宋人多數(shù)不懂詩(shī)是要用形象思維的,一反唐人規(guī)律,所以~。(毛澤東《給陳毅同志談詩(shī)的一封信》) Most Song poets did not understand that poetry must convey ideas by means of images,and they disregarded the tradition of Tang poetry,with the result that what they wrote was quite flat. ? 人生富貴功名,是身外之物;但世人一見(jiàn)了功名,便舍著性命去求他,及至到手之后,~。(《儒林外史》1) Inhuman life riches,rank,success and fame are external things.Men will risk their lives in the search for them; yet once they have them within their grasp,the taste is no better than chewed tallow. 味同嚼蠟wei tong jiao lalike chewing tallow or wax—(of a composition or speech) boring 味同嚼蠟like chewing tallow or wax;as dry as dust;dull;insipid |
